Output 65638574c4131a7335828478d88a91dfa5af17c7be8ec23a0e81e893e107e5b3:13

value
30800499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eb345094976fb9a8afd1e91b433cacb500eab0e OP_EQUAL
address
MPptZgcyVoMvaaya7FxqKcFVb37QNzy2Z8
transaction
65638574c4131a7335828478d88a91dfa5af17c7be8ec23a0e81e893e107e5b3
spent
true